Quests are objectives in Bloons Card Storm that can be completed to earn rewards. Quests are accessed from the main menu. The game tracks progress towards all active quests and displays any quests that the player has made progress on at the end of a match. Once completed, the player can claim a quest's rewards. The player cannot make progress towards quests in the Tutorial, Training, or Private Matches. Quests were introduced in the Full Playable test.

There are two types of quests: Daily Quests and Weekly Quests. Each quest type has three slots, and the player can have up to two quests per slot (one active quest and a second quest that replaces it once completed). If a quest slot has two quests, the player can remove the active quest (even if it is already complete) to replace it with the next quest. Daily Quests are unlocked each day at 8:00 AM UTC and reward Monkey Money 20 Monkey Money and 150 Tokens of a random type (prior to Full Playable test, each Daily Quest rewarded amounts of Monkey Money, but the same amount of Tokens). Weekly Quests are unlocked every Monday at 8:00 AM UTC and reward Monkey Money 150 Monkey Money and 1,000 Tokens of a random type.

Strategy

[edit | edit source]
This section was last updated for: version 6.2

The general strategy for completing quests is to grind multiple games on Prologue of Amelia's Adventure or the Daily Challenge; those game modes have more leniency to focus on grinding quests, unlike in Duels or Ranked. Create decks specifically catered to grinding quests, and adapt them based on the type of quest(s) available. Striker's Adventure can also work for quests that involve grinding general quests.

Quest Tips
Win X Games / Win X Games with <hero> / Complete X Games
  • Battle 3 of the Prologue of Amelia's Adventure can be played repeatedly to complete this quest quickly.
  • For the fastest results, use an aggro deck, which ends games quickly (regardless of winning/losing).
    • For the Quincy/Gwendolin quests, using an aggro deck dedicated to these heroes is recommended for the quickest results.
  • For the "Complete X Games" quest, simply going to the pre-match screen and then leaving counts as a completed game.
Draw X Cards
  • Pick a deck that heavily involves draw cards and plenty of card spending.
  • To allow stalling of rounds to draw so many cards, playing Battle 1 or 2 of Prologue of Amelia's Adventure is recommended.
Play X Bloon cards / Play X <type> Bloon cards
  • The method of completing this quest depends on the type.
    • Bloons: Bloons with multiple charges are recommended. Aggro swarm decks help complete this quest quickly.
    • Basic: Similar to Bloons, but focus only on aggro swarm decks.
    • Advanced: Bloons with multiple charges are recommended. Not many Advanced Bloons have more than 2 charges, and most are not Common. However, Discount Bloon offers the most Bloons per card, and there are plenty of Uncommon Advanced Bloons. Midrange decks may support a deck with plenty of Advanced Bloon cards.
    • Large: Play a deck that heavily involves Large Bloon spam, such as MOABs and BFBs.
  • Battle 3 of Prologue of Amelia's Adventure is recommended for the Bloons and Basic quests, while Battle 1-2 should be done for the others.
Play X <type> Monkey cards
  • The method of completing this quest depends on the type.
  • Battles 1-2 of Prologue of Amelia's Adventure can be played long enough to draw and play enough Monkeys.
Play X <type> Power cards
Deal 1200 Damage to Opposing Heroes
  • Because AI heroes will never surrender, always play Prologue of Amelia's Adventure or Daily Challenge. Human opponents may surrender pre-emptively if they know they'll be beaten after your turn.
  • If a Boss Battle is available, the first three phases have enough combined health to fully complete this quest.
  • Avoid using Life Drain Bloon as the main source of damage, as its health removal does not count towards damage dealt by any means.
Pop X Bloons / Pop X Bloons with <Monkey type> / Pop 25 Bloons with Hero Abilities
  • The method of completing this quest for specific Monkeys depends on the type. If the quest is for Monkey type or Hero Abilities, prioritize a Monkey or Hero Ability to do the final pop.
    • Hero Abilities: Recommended to only use Quincy or Adora for this achievement. Gwen's Flame Strike and Obyn's Spirit Strike are the only direct abilities of themselves to count. Striker's Concussive Shell is slow and unreliable. Ezili's Big Voodoo is also unreliable except versus Immobile Bloons. Amelia, Zee Jay, and Mountain Obyn should never be used, since none of them can contribute progress for this Quest.
    • Primary: Use a deck that focuses on Primary Monkeys. Blade Maelstrom helps pop large amounts for later rounds, while Dart Monkey Twins deals with early-game. Boss Battles with Bomb-centric strategies also help.
    • Military: Use a deck that focuses on Military Monkeys. There are not many Military Monkeys with 1 reload and lack randomness, and few have grouped damage. However, The Big One is fairly reliable at one-shotting bloons. Use Striker, especially his final passive and Orders Received.
    • Magic: Thunder Druid is a board clear that is very suitable for this achievement. Sun Temple against Battle 1-2 of Prologue of Amelia's Adventure is also recommended.
  • Battles 1-2 of Prologue of Amelia's Adventure can be played to pop as many bloons for long enough or as many times as possible.
Use X Bloontonium
  • Try a Bloontonium-heavy hero such as Adora, and use a hybrid Miner + Bloon deck to build up Bloontonium from as many sources as possible.
  • Battles 1-2 of Prologue of Amelia's Adventure can be played to use up Bloontonium for as long as possible.
Gain X Gold
  • Use a loadout that depends largely on early investment with Farms and spending a lot on mid-game Bloon spam.
  • Battles 1-2 of Prologue of Amelia's Adventure can be played to spend Gold for as long as possible.
